Providing for consideration of the bill (H.R. 2095) to amend title 49, United States Code, to prevent railroad fatalities, injuries, and hazardous materials releases, to authorize the Federal Railroad Safety Administration, and for other purposes.

10/17/2007--Passed House without amendment.    (There are 2 other summaries)

Sets forth the rule for consideration of H.R. 2095 (Federal Railroad Safety Improvement Act of 2007).
